Output e32ab21538c74b58fb83ec31126329506fb3bac59c4be31ff09f51ebfd41295d:0

value
59959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94835522f3ebc81b8a03a2a4b3af50930a20a191 OP_EQUAL
address
3FEHG5fUGcjv3QEymbcsD6TTHMKBuVyU2p
transaction
e32ab21538c74b58fb83ec31126329506fb3bac59c4be31ff09f51ebfd41295d
spent
true